沁水盆地南部3号煤层含气量主控地质因素分析 被引量:6

Analysis of 3th Coal Seam's Main Controlling Geological Factors of Gas Content in Southern Qinshui Basin

摘要 以沁水盆地南部四个矿区不同深度的3号煤岩样品为研究对象,采用压汞、低温液氮吸附、显微镜和扫描电镜等试验方法对煤样的孔径、裂缝和孔隙连通性、渗透性以及吸附性进行表征,结合研究区的构造特征、储层特征以及水动力特征,研究该地区3号煤层含气量的主控地质因素。研究区处于一个大型复式向斜构造上,3号煤层煤样总比表面积和总比孔容积与煤层埋深呈负向关系。煤岩类型以半亮煤为主,镜质组含量较高,生气能力较强,顶底板密封性较好。盆地接受大气降水,从向斜翼部流向轴部,有效阻止了煤层气的逸散。研究结果表明,该区3号煤层含气量主控地质因素包括:煤岩类型、孔裂隙结构、水动力特征以及顶底板封闭性,煤层气的富集是上述几项地质因素耦合作用的结果。 In the study of the coal samples from four mines at different depths in southern Qinshui Basin, use the test methods of mercury, low temperature nitrogen adsorption, microscopy and scanning electron microscopy to characteristic the aperture, cracks and pore connectivity, permeability and adsorption of the coal samples. Com- bined with the structural characteristics and hydrodynamic characteristics of the study area to study the 3th eoalbed' s main control geological factors of gas content of the region . The study area in a large syncline structure and the 3th coal seam specific surface area and pore volume has negative relationship with the depth increased, coal types give priority to semi-bright coaX, vitrinite content is high, has strong gas production ability and better tightness of roof and floor, the basin accept atmospheric precipitation, flows from the syncline wing shaft portion, which ef- fectively prevent the escape of CBM. The results showed that the main geological factors of 3th coalbed in this area include : coal rock type, pore fissure structure, hydrodynamic characteristics and closed roof and floor, enrichment of CBM is a result of the coupling of several geological factors.
